Shiv Sena president Uddhav Thackeray cautions banks, insurance companies from harassing farmers

| @indiablooms | Jun 22, 2019, at 05:14 pm

Aurangabad, Maharashtra, Jun 22 (UNI) Taking a stock of the Crop Insurance Help Center setup by his party in this district, Shiv Sena president Uddhav Thackeray said for the farmers' distress, roadmap should be debt-free instead of loan waiver.

Addressing the farmers at Lasur station in the Gangapur taluka, Thackeray said his party will protest against those banks as well as insurance companies who dupe and harass farmers seeking loans and added that the offices of such unscrupulous institutions will be closed.

The Sena chief also raised the issue of middlemen. It is because of these middlemen, the benefits of such schemes doesn't reach farmers, he underlined.
 
Thackeray was accompanied by the district guardian minister Eknath Shinde, fomer MP Chandrakant Khaire, district party chief Ambadas Danve, Zilla Parishad president Devyani Dongaonkar, MLA Sanjay Shirsat and several other leaders.
